Check your contracts
I assume most of the UK drivers here use “Wise” for invoicing. I’ve discovered this portion of the contract which states each day of using your own device, you are owed an additional £1.80.
I have never been paid this and exclusively use my own device (or did, before I stopped working there recently).
Was thinking of raising it with the ethics guys
